SubjectRe: [PATCH] video: fbdev: added driver for sharp memory lcd displays
Hi Rodrigo,

Thank you for the patch! Perhaps something to improve:

[auto build test WARNING on linux/master]
[also build test WARNING on robh/for-next linus/master v5.4 next-20191208]
[if your patch is applied to the wrong git tree, please drop us a note to help
improve the system. BTW, we also suggest to use '--base' option to specify the
base tree in git format-patch, please see https://stackoverflow.com/a/37406982]

url: https://github.com/0day-ci/linux/commits/Rodrigo-Rolim-Mendes-de-Alencar/video-fbdev-added-driver-for-sharp-memory-lcd-displays/20191207-112607
base: https://git.kernel.org/pub/scm/linux/kernel/git/torvalds/linux.git 26bc672134241a080a83b2ab9aa8abede8d30e1c
reproduce:
# apt-get install sparse
# sparse version: v0.6.1-91-g817270f-dirty
make ARCH=x86_64 allmodconfig
make C=1 CF='-fdiagnostic-prefix -D__CHECK_ENDIAN__'

If you fix the issue, kindly add following tag
Reported-by: kbuild test robot <lkp@intel.com>


sparse warnings: (new ones prefixed by >>)

>> drivers/video/fbdev/smemlcdfb.c:71:29: sparse: sparse: incorrect type in initializer (different address spaces) @@ expected unsigned char [usertype] *vmem @@ got signed char [usertype] *vmem @@
>> drivers/video/fbdev/smemlcdfb.c:71:29: sparse: expected unsigned char [usertype] *vmem
>> drivers/video/fbdev/smemlcdfb.c:71:29: sparse: got char [noderef] <asn:2> *screen_base

vim +71 drivers/video/fbdev/smemlcdfb.c

67
68 static void smemlcd_update(struct smemlcd_par *par)
69 {
70 struct spi_device *spi = par->spi;
> 71 u8 *vmem = par->info->screen_base;
72 u8 *buf_ptr = par->spi_buf;
73 int ret;
74 u32 i,j;
75
76 if (par->start + par->height > par->info->var.yres) {
77 par->start = 0;
78 par->height = 0;
79 }
80 /* go to start line */
81 vmem += par->start * par->vmem_width;
82 /* update vcom */
83 par->vcom ^= SMEMLCD_FRAME_INVERSION;
84 /* mode selection */
85 *(buf_ptr++) = (par->height)? (SMEMLCD_DATA_UPDATE | par->vcom) : par->vcom;
86
87 /* not all SPI masters have LSB-first mode, bitrev8 is used */
88 for (i = par->start + 1; i < par->start + par->height + 1; i++) {
89 /* gate line address */
90 *(buf_ptr++) = bitrev8(i);
91 /* data writing */
92 for (j = 0; j < par->spi_width; j++)
93 *(buf_ptr++) = bitrev8(*(vmem++));
94 /* dummy data */
95 *(buf_ptr++) = SMEMLCD_DUMMY_DATA;
96 /* video memory alignment */
97 for (; j < par->vmem_width; j++)
98 vmem++;
99 }
100 /* dummy data */
101 *(buf_ptr++) = SMEMLCD_DUMMY_DATA;
102
103 ret = spi_write(spi, &(par->spi_buf[0]), par->height * (par->spi_width + 2) + 2);
104 if (ret < 0)
105 dev_err(&spi->dev, "Couldn't send SPI command.\n");
106
107 par->start = U32_MAX;
108 par->height = 0;
109 }
110
